Introduction of agra taj mahal
Taj Mahal in Agra is synonymous with India. The eternal beauty of the monument lies in its location, architecture and the feeling that went behind its construction. For times immemorial the Taj will stand as a symbol of eternal love. The Taj Mahal in India is a must visit for everyone at least once in a lifetime.The Taj Mahal finds its place amongst the 7 wonders of the World. It is definitely one of the most photographed and written monuments of the World. The majestic Taj Mahal attracts tourists from far and away. The architectural magnificence and aesthetic beauty of the Taj Mahal ensures that people return to see to time and again.
The great Mughal Emperor Shahjahan (1592-1666) got the Taj Mahal built over a period of 22 years. Besides the Taj Mahal he was the man behind other popular monuments Red Fort and Jama Masjid of Delhi. He brought about modifications in the Agra Fort too.
The architectural wonder of the Taj Mahal is a monument of love, purity and beauty that Shah Jahan had built in the loving memory of his beloved wife Mumtaz Mahal. Thus, the Taj Mahal is essentially the mausoleum of the mughal Empress Mumtaz Mahal.
The Taj Mahal complex has a main gateway, an elaborate garden, a mosque and a prayer house besides the mausoleum. The extensive use of the marble and precious stones on the Taj Mahal make it a wonderful wonder.
Taj is the salute to the Indian womanhood that till date inspires people to love. In fact the beauty of Taj Mahal has inspired people, poets and painters. No words or pictures can do justice to the loveliness of the Taj. One has to see it to believe it and experience it to enjoy it.
Besides the Taj Mahal, Agra boasts of a number of tourist attractions such as Agra Fort, Sikandra, and Itmad-ud Daulah Tomb. Then there are various excursion options also possible from Agra including those to Fatehpur Sikri, Mathura and Vrindavan.
The best time to visit the Taj Mahal in Agra is in the winter months from October to March. The summer and the monsoon months are best avoided.
There are a number of luxury hotels in Agra that offer views of the Taj Mahal from their rooms. The best of facilities and the most efficient of services may be enjoyed at the luxury hotels around Taj Mahal.
Agra, the city of Taj is easily accessible through air, rail and road. Delhi the capital city of India acts as the main gateway to Agra. There are regular flights to Agra. Express trains from Delhi take you to Agra in less than two hours.

agra Taj Mahal of History

On the bank of River Yamsua, the third Mughal Emperor Shah Jahan immortalized his love for his beloved queen Mumtaj Mahal by constructing this marble wonder as a tribute to her, when she died during the birth of their fourteenth child. There is a controversy on the name of the chief architect of Taj but there are many sources, which propose the name of the Indian architect of Persian origin known as Ustad Ahmad Lahori for the credit. Its construction began in 1630 and master builders, architects, skilled masons and sculptors were imported from all over the world including Persia and Europe to contribute to the beauty of Taj. Twelve years of hard labor of about 20,000 laborers and millions of rupees went into its making. 
There are five main elements of the Taj complex - the main gateway or 'Darwazah', the garden with its ingenious waterways or 'Bageecha', the mosque or 'Maszid', the rest house or 'Naqqar Khana' and the main tomb building or 'Rauza'. The actual graves are kept inside while the cenotaphs are placed just above them to be viewed by the general public. The beautiful marble inlay work known as 'Pietra Dura' and the well-planned gardens of Taj with their water channels and lotus pools are some of the most impressive things to see here.




agra Taj Mahal of Timings

Timings:
Every Day, (except Friday), Sunrise to Sunset
Night, 8:30 PM to 12:30 AM (On Full moon night, two days before and two days after)

Day Fee:
Rs 750 (Foreigners)
Rs 510 (Citizens of SAARC and BIMSTEC Countries)
Rs 20 (Indian)
Entry Free for children below 15 years of age


Night Fee: 
Rs 750 (Adult, Foreign)
Rs 510 (Adult, Indian)
Rs 500 (Child 3-15 Years, Indian & Foreign)
Entry free for child below 3 years of age


The timings of visiting the Taj Mahal are set by the Archeological Survey of India. The Taj is opened all days of the week except for Fridays, when it is opened in the afternoon only for those who have to attend prayers at the Taj Mosque. The timings are from sunrise to sunset. Tickets are available throughout the day from the western and eastern gate, and at the southern gate tickets are available from 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M. The tourists can spend any number of hours inside the Taj complex from sunrise to sunset.

Night viewing at the Taj Mahal, from 8:30 PM to 12:30 AM, is allowed only on five nights in a month: one, on the full moon night, two days before it and two days after it, except for Fridays. However, night viewing is limited to maximum 400 people per night, divided into eight batches of 50 each and each batch is allowed to visit for a maximum duration of 30 minutes. The tickets for night viewing have to be booked one day (24 hours) in advance from the booking counter located in the office of the Archeological Survey of India, Agra Circle, 22 The Mall, Agra, Uttar Pradesh in between 10:00 AM to 6:00 PM.

Ticketing
ENTRY FEE FOR VARIOUS MONUMENTS IN AGRA
MonumentsFor Indian TouristFor Foreign Tourist
A.S.I.A.D.A.TotalA.S.I.A.D.A.Total
Rs.Rs.Rs.Rs.Rs.Rs.
Taj Mahal101020250500750
Taj Museum, Taj Mahal5Nil55Nil5
Agra Fort10102025050300
Fatehpur Sikri10102025010260
Akbar's Tomb Sikandra551010010110
Mariyam Tomb, Sikandra5Nil5100Nil100
Ram Bagh5Nil5100Nil100
Itmad-ud-Daula551010010110
Mehtab Bag5Nil5100Nil100
Note-
Tourists are supposed to buy both the ASI and ADA tickets to visit the various monuments in Agra.
For All the monuments ASI Charges Indian fee from the nnationals of SAARC and BIMSTEC countries while no such provision has been made ADA tickets.
No entry fee for children below the age of 15 years (both Indian and Foreigner).
Taj Mahal is closed on every Friday.
Agra Development Authority (A.D.A.) does not levy any toll tax on Friday at any monument.
Ticket window & cloak room for Taj Eastern Gate are available at Shilpgram and Cloak room for Taj Western Gate is available at Taj Shopping Complex.
